After a wreck, bills start arriving before you’re fully healed. That’s when many riders search for a bike accident settlement calculator or a “rough payout” estimate.
In Mauldin, that urgency is especially common because many riders are commuting for work, school, or appointments and can’t easily pause their lives. A calculator can help you organize the kinds of losses that may be considered, such as:
- ER/urgent care visits, imaging, and follow-up treatment
- physical therapy and mobility support
- prescription costs
- documented time missed from work
- out-of-pocket costs tied to recovery
- non-economic impacts like pain, sleep disruption, and reduced ability to ride or work
But here’s the key: in real settlement negotiations, the “math” only works if the facts and records support it.
